#d283f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d283f8 is composed of 82.4% red, 51.4%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.3% cyan, 47.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 280.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 74.3%. #d283f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a507f1.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#d283f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d283f8 has RGB values of R:210, G:131,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 13796344.

Shades and Tints of #d283f8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040006 is the darkest color, while #faf2fe is the lightest one.
